In a deeply emotional revelation, veteran Nigerian actress Dupe Jaiyesimi has shared her struggles with childlessness as she approaches her 60th birthday. In an interview with Biola Adebayo, the once-prominent Yoruba actress recounted the heartbreak, betrayal, and personal trials that shaped her journey.
Dupe Jaiyesimi recalled a devastating chapter in her life—becoming pregnant at 40, only to be told by her doctor that the baby was not in her womb. The diagnosis was an ectopic pregnancy, where the fetus grows outside the uterus, making it impossible to carry to term. The loss left her questioning fate and struggling with the weight of unfulfilled motherhood.
Sadly, her sorrow was compounded by betrayal. While she was still mourning her loss, her husband introduced another woman into their home—a woman already carrying his child. The heartbreak of this betrayal ultimately led her to walk away from the marriage.
Determined to become a mother, Dupe attempted two rounds of IVF, but both efforts failed. She also considered adoption, but her late mother discouraged her from going through with it. With each attempt, her hopes dimmed, but she refused to let go of the dream completely.
Once a familiar face in Yoruba films, Dupe Jaiyesimi has been absent from the industry for over seven years. She has neither featured in movies nor produced any projects of her own. Her retreat from the limelight was, in part, due to the emotional and personal battles she faced.
Despite all the pain and disappointment, Dupe remains hopeful. She believes that as long as she is alive, there is still a chance for her to experience the joy of motherhood. Her unwavering faith in the future is what keeps her going.
